Growth While Minimizing Waste
Biodegradable mulch films offer a eco-friendly solution for gardeners seeking to boost soil health while reducing environmental impact. These innovative films rot naturally over time, returning valuable nutrients to the soil and reducing the need for synthetic alternatives.
Unlike conventional plastic mulches, biodegradable films are made from renewable resources such as cellulose, making them a environmentally sound choice.
They provide a variety of advantages including weed suppression, moisture retention, and temperature regulation, ultimately aiding to healthier crop yields and a more responsible agricultural system.

Minimizing Plastic Footprint in Agriculture: Biodegradability and Compostability Solutions
Plastic pollution has become a significant concern in agriculture, with plastic mulches, packaging, film posing a hazard to the environment. However, innovative strategies are emerging to reduce this burden. Biodegradable and compostable materials offer a eco-friendly alternative to traditional plastics. These options break down naturally over time, minimizing their lifespan in landfills and reducing the build-up of plastic waste.
Biodegradable mulches, for example, rot quickly after harvest, returning nutrients to the soil. Compostable packaging can be added into composting systems, closing the loop and creating valuable fertilizer.
